How they compare
United Republic of Tanzania currently reports 29.9% against 29.8% in Solomon Islands, a difference of 0.1%.
Across all 25 years both countries report, United Republic of Tanzania has been ahead every year.
Solomon Islands ranks 32nd and United Republic of Tanzania ranks 29th of 176 countries.
United Republic of Tanzania has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Solomon Islands | United Republic of Tanzania |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 32.4% | 44.5% | 12.1% | United Republic of Tanzania |
| 2010s | 31.0% | 35.5% | 4.5% | United Republic of Tanzania |
| 2020s | 29.3% | 30.4% | 1.1% | United Republic of Tanzania |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
